Give an example to show that when two prime numbers are added, the result
may be an odd number.

Respuesta :

jacinta57
jacinta57 jacinta57
  • 07-04-2021

Answer:

2+3=5

Step-by-step explanation:

prime numbers =2 and 3

sum =5 which is odd
